#4abdff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4abdff is composed of 29% red, 74.1%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71% cyan, 25.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 201.9 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 64.5%. #4abdff color hex could be obtained by blending #94ffff with #007bff. Closest websafe color is: #33ccff.

Shades and Tints of #4abdff

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000a0f is the darkest color, while #fbf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4abdff

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ea6ab is the less saturated color, while #4abdff is the most saturated one.
